The first thing that will surprise you about the Meliá Las Dunas is its exotic offer of bungalows with sea views. The Meliá Las Dunas provides modern and welcoming rooms for two people, individual use and for multi-occupancy. There are 5 different types of rooms, located in the two different areas: one for families and the other quieter area for adults or couples, and distributed amongst 2 storey bungalows with pretty views of the gardens and the sea. Their finely decorated interiors and luxury facilities ensure the enjoyment of an unforgettable vacation.

Melia Las Dunas – April 9–16, 2025 We recently stayed at Melia Las Dunas in Cayo Santa Maria, Cuba, with a large group of 19 family members, including children ranging from 4 to 15 years old. Sadly, our experience was far below expectations. We went in with open minds and realistic expectations—understanding that Cuba might not offer top-tier food—and we were prepared. However, what we encountered went far beyond food concerns and into serious issues with cleanliness, service, and basic hospitality. To start with something positive, the resort grounds were beautiful and well-maintained. But everything else left us extremely disappointed. Our rooms were old, dirty, and lacking essential items. We were provided only one thin sheet to sleep with, and the additional blankets smelled heavily of mold. The fridges were filthy—completely unusable for the snacks and drinks we brought specifically for the kids. The room phones didn’t work, and neither did the TV at first. Oddly enough, the maintenance person showed up before we even had a chance to call, which was concerning, although he did manage to get the TV running. Getting basic items like toilet paper and towels was a daily struggle. We had to repeatedly ask, almost beg, just to get them. With children in the group, this became especially stressful. These are not luxuries—these are basic expectations that were not met. Checking in was another headache. Despite arriving together as a group of 19, it took over two hours to get checked in. This was exhausting, especially with kids as young as four years old who had been traveling all day. The food was extremely poor in both quality and hygiene. There was little variety, very few kid-friendly options, and the sight of cockroaches in the kitchen made meals uncomfortable. The entertainment was equally disappointing—disorganized, low-energy, and not suitable for engaging children or families. To top it all off, some of our personal belongings went missing from our bags. When I spoke with the general manager about all of these issues—lack of supplies, unsanitary conditions, missing items—I was met with a shrug and told, “This is all we have.” That kind of indifference from hotel management is unacceptable. We didn’t come expecting luxury. We came to enjoy quality time as a family, and we would have been happy with clean rooms, working amenities, decent food, and basic hospitality. Unfortunately, even that was too much to ask. I hope this feedback is taken seriously—for the sake of future guests, especially families with young children.

Just got home from MLD last night and wanted to write a review while everything is fresh in my mind. We got married at the this hotel in 2009 and decided to go back and show our daughter the resort. We reached out to the hotel prior to departure as we were returning guests and planned on celebrating our daughter’s 13th birthday while we were there. We were contacted by Miguel who immediately put us in contact with Annabelle who took better care of us than we could have ever imagined. We have been travelling to Cuba for 20 years and have never been treated so well. Annabelle is truly amazing. She cares so much about her guests and goes out of her way to make sure you have everything you need and more. Even checked in on us on her day off! Annabelle decorated our room for our daughter’s birthday and planned a very special dinner for her with a birthday cake. We will miss you Annabelle but you will be the reason we come back next year! The resort has aged however the cleanliness, service and food are still top notch. Diane did a fabulous job keeping our room clean. The wait staff at restaurants and bars all provided top notch service. There were no lineups for food and you never had to wait for a drink. The servers at the entertainment pool were excellent. The nicest people who always had a smile on their faces. Food, although typical for Cuba we found very good. At the buffet we mostly ate from the grilling stations and pasta station and have zero complaints. (Nobody from our group got sick!) We will miss our morning churros from the buffet and pizza lunch from the Italian restaurant! (Get there early if you want pizza for lunch! They only have so many doughs per day and it goes quick!) We enjoyed the Columbus restaurant for dinner as well as the Oriental. Special thanks to Yilena for decorating for our daughter’s birthday dinner and having the entire restaurant join in singing Happy Birthday! That was something she won’t forget! Thank you MLD for an amazing week! We will definitely be back!
